British & Irish Lions hopeful Chris Cusiter will return to The Borders team for the Celtic League clash at Ulster on Friday.
Scrum-half Cusiter was forced to miss Scotland's final Six Nations game against England last weekend with an Achilles injury but is available for the match at Ravenhill.
The return of the 22-year-old is a bonus for Lions coach Sir Clive Woodward, with Cusiter emerging as a potential tourist for the summer tour of New Zealand.
Borders head coach Steve Bates said: "Chris is fine now. He trained with us and is confident with his recovery."
